This 11-round epic, held in Manchester, was a tale of resilience, power, and the unpredictable nature of the sweet science.

The fight began with a bang, quite literally, as Wardley, the defending WBO champion, unleashed a lightning-fast right hook that sent Dubois to the canvas within the first 10 seconds. It was a stunning start, reminiscent of Wardley's previous quick-fire victories. However, Dubois, known for his power, quickly demonstrated why he's a force to be reckoned with. He weathered the early storm and began to turn the tide in his favor.

What's particularly intriguing about this bout is the psychological aspect. Dubois, having suffered previous losses to boxing greats like Oleksandr Usyk, entered the ring with something to prove. His late arrival, reminiscent of his pre-fight party antics before the Usyk fight, could have been a sign of nerves or a lack of focus. Yet, he showed incredible mental fortitude by not letting this affect his performance.

As the rounds progressed, Dubois' power punches took a toll on Wardley. The champion, who had risen from 'white collar' boxing to the pinnacle of the sport, showcased his resilience. He absorbed punishment that would have felled lesser fighters, but his refusal to go down may have been his undoing. Personally, I believe this is where the narrative of the fight shifts from a physical to a mental battle.

Wardley, despite his toughness, was visibly shaken. His swollen eye and damaged nose were testaments to Dubois' relentless assault. The ninth round, with its break, offered a brief respite, but it was clear that Wardley was on borrowed time. The 11th round, with Dubois' flurry of punches, was the final act in this dramatic contest. Referee Howard Foster's decision to wave off the fight was a wise one, ensuring the safety of both warriors.
